Найдите ответы на ваши вопросы по программированию

Присоединяйтесь к сообществу разработчиков, делитесь знаниями и получайте помощь

или

Сообщество

Получите помощь от опытных разработчиков и помогайте другим

Быстрые ответы

Получайте ответы на ваши вопросы в течение нескольких минут

Репутация

Зарабатывайте репутацию и ачивки за помощь другим

32
голоса
5
ответов
132
просмотров
Использование async/await с циклом forEach

Есть ли проблемы с использованием async/await в цикле forEach? Я пытаюсь пройтись по массиву файлов и использовать await для получения содержимого каждого файла.

import fs from 'fs-promise'

async function printFiles () {
  const files = await getFilePaths() // Предполагаем,...
10
голоса
5
ответов
132
просмотров
Как работает "cat << EOF" в bash?

Я столкнулся с необходимостью написать скрипт для ввода многострочного текста в программу (psql).

После немного поиска в интернете, я нашел следующий синтаксис, который работает:

cat << EOF | psql ---params BEGIN;

pg_dump ----something

update table .... statement ...;

END; EOF

Этот...

6
голоса
3
ответов
132
просмотров
Как конкатенировать строки?

Вот описание проблемы для StackOverflow на русском языке:


Как мне конкатенировать следующие комбинации типов:

str и str String и str String и String


Если вам нужно больше деталей, дайте знать!

0
голоса
4
ответов
132
просмотров
Работает ли Apollo Client на Node.js?

Я ищу библиотеку GraphQL-клиента, которая должна работать на Node.js для проведения тестирования и создания некоторого мэшапа данных — не в производственной среде. Везде, где я использую Apollo, например, в react-apollo и graphql-server-express от Apollo. Мои требования довольно...

8
голоса
5
ответов
131
просмотров
Как экспортировать информацию из массива JavaScript в CSV (на стороне клиента)?

Я знаю, что существует множество вопросов на эту тему, но мне нужно сделать это с использованием JavaScript. Я использую Dojo 1.8 и у меня есть вся информация об атрибутах в массиве, который выглядит следующим образом:

[["name1", "city_name1", ...], ["name2", "city_name2", ...]]

Кто-нибудь...

54
голоса
5
ответов
130
просмотров
Как заменить все вхождения строки в JavaScript?

Проблема с удалением всех вхождений подстроки в строке

У меня есть следующая строка:

string = "Test abc test test abc test test test abc test test abc";

С помощью следующей команды я пытаюсь удалить подстроку abc:

string = string.replace('abc', '');

Однако, эта...

0
голоса
1
ответов
130
просмотров
"Сброс Stdout в Node.js?"

Заголовок: Как произвести сброс стандартного вывода в Node.js, как это делается в Python?

Описание проблемы:

Я ищу способ сброса стандартного вывода (stdout) в Node.js, аналогично тому, как это делается в Python и других языках программирования.

Например, в Python я могу использовать следующий...

0
голоса
4
ответов
130
просмотров
Итерация по диапазону дат в NodeJS

Я хотел бы пройтись по диапазону календарных дат, увеличивая дату на один день в каждой итерации. Я использовал что-то, основанное на JodaTime в Java. Есть ли что-то похожее в Node.js?

0
голоса
1
ответов
130
просмотров
В чем разница между передачей значения функции по ссылке и передачей через Box?

В чем разница между передачей значения функции по ссылке и передачей "по коробке"?

В приведенном коде рассматривается вопрос о разнице между передачей переменной, хранящейся в стеке, и переменной, хранящейся в куче, в функции. Программа выглядит так:

fn main() {
    let mut stack_a =...
16
голоса
5
ответов
129
просмотров
Преобразование Unix-метки времени в формат времени в JavaScript

Я сохраняю время в базе данных MySQL в формате Unix timestamp, и это значение отправляется в код JavaScript. Как я могу извлечь только время из этого значения?

Например, мне нужно получить время в формате HH/MM/SS.